Comment intégrer facebook inscription/s'inscrire sur régulier de connexion d'un site web?
J'ai un problème de la pensée de l'intégration de la 3e partie de connexion (aussi faire le silence s'inscrire) sur le site où est déjà utilisé une connexion/s'inscrire système.
Fondamentalement la connexion actuelle est tout à fait normal:
- Comme utilisateur saisit site web de la session
la classe détermine s'il faut
re-connexion. - Lors de la connexion de l'utilisateur tous les types de sessions et les cookies sont définis et
l'utilisateur d'obtenir l'accès aux zones restreintes.
Utilisateurs de table dans mysql a beaucoup de champs aussi des champs de mot de passe.
Ce que je pose, c'est comment vous créez la saisie par l'utilisateur dans la même table de base de données si elle n'est pas là et ne complète (silencieux) vous inscrire à facebook de l'utilisateur.
OriginalL'auteur arma | 2010-11-21
Vous devez vous connecter pour publier un commentaire.
Eh bien, je ne suis pas sûr de ce que vous entendez par silencieux registre, mais vous pouvez simplifier votre processus d'inscription si l'utilisateur est connecté à Facebook.
C'est ce que nous faisons:
Nous avons une autre table de base de données de Facebook, les utilisateurs - nous stocker le Facebook ID Unique et l'adresse électronique de l'utilisateur.
L'adresse e-mail est très important - c'est ce que nous utilisons pour effectuer une authentification unique, en tant qu'utilisateur de Facebook adresse e-mail doit correspondre à l'adresse e-mail pour le site web.
Aussi facebook de la documentation est un peu confus pour moi car je n'ai jamais utilisé avant.
OriginalL'auteur RPM1984
OpenID est un moyen sûr, rapide, et simple de la façon de se connecter à des sites web.
😀
utiliser open id ...
il y a beaucoup de lib à cette adresse http://wiki.openid.net/w/page/12995176/Libraries
chaque utilisateur peut se connecter avec un utilisateur de facebook et gmail, et vous devez donner à chaque id d'utilisateur et les modèles de relations pour l'accès
Les utilisateurs vont vous montrer doigt du milieu si vous leur demandez de faire openID au lieu de Facebook. Qu'est ce qu'ils vont faire.
OriginalL'auteur Mohammad Efazati
Je suis également nouveau à cela, mais à une idée de comment le faire et je voudrais le partager.
Vous pouvez utiliser l'API Javascript fourni par Facebook, Google+ etc ... pour faciliter la connexion sur le site. L'API a intégré les méthodes invoquées pour l'authentification et de l'extraction de données du compte de l'utilisateur(qui est personnalisable à ce que les données de l'utilisateur à la traction). Entre le code javascript, vous pouvez écrire appel ajax à votre script de serveur avec les données de l'utilisateur(obtenu à partir de la troisième partie serveur) pour la mise à l'utilisateur d'inscription ou de connexion dans votre système, ce que jamais envie de faire.
Oui la configuration de tous ces bits maux de tête 🙁
OriginalL'auteur A.K. Mahana